AMPHOSOL® HCA-HP

1 of 27 products in this brand
AMPHOSOL® HCA-HP is a mild amphoteric surfactant derived from coco methyl esters, providing foam boosting and viscosity building in a wide range of personal care, hard surface cleaning, and specialty foamer applications. It is preserved with excess alkalinity, which allows the formulator flexibility when choosing a preservative for their finished formulation.

INCI Name: Cocamidopropyl Betaine

Functions: Anti-Static Agent, Cosurfactant, Foam Booster, Surfactant, Surfactant (Amphoteric), Thickener, Viscosity Modifier

Certifications & Compliance: Kosher, Safer Choice

Benefit Claims: Excess Alkalinity Preserved, Foam Enhancement, Foaming, Mild, Static Reduction, Viscosity Boosting

Synonyms: 1-Propanaminium, 3-amino-N-(carboxymethyl)-N,N-dimethyl-, N-coco acyl derivs., hydroxides, inner salts

Safety & Health

Toxicity

AMPHOSOL HCA-HP is slightly to practically non-toxic orally (LD₅₀ = 4.9 to 7.45 g/kg), and causes moderate eye and minimal skin irritation at 10% active when tested under neutral pH conditions.

Storage & Handling

Storage & Handling
  • Normal safety precautions (i.e., gloves and safety goggles) should be employed when handling AMPHOSOL HCA-HP. Contact with the eyes and prolonged contact with the skin should be avoided. Wash thoroughly after handling material.
  • Bulk Storage Information: Recommended material of construction for storage: fiberglass. It is recommended that AMPHOSOL HCA-HP be stored in sealed containers and kept at temperatures between 40°F (4°C) and 110°F (43.3°C). Avoid overheating or freezing. If material is frozen, mild heat and agitation are recommended to ensure the material is homogeneous before use.
